Costa Blackfin Pro

Costa Blackfin Pro polarized sunglasses are a good option for fishermen who want to protect their eyes from harmful glare. These sunglasses offer an excellent polarization effect, which is ideal for fishing at dawn and dusk. Their lenses shine in low light and help you locate structure and fish holding close to the bottom. They also give you exceptional vision during evening hatches.

Blackfin PRO sunglasses are an enhanced version of Costa’s original Blackfin, and feature a vented and fully adjustable nose pad. They are also made from environmentally friendly bio-resin nylon and come with Costa 580 lens technology. The lenses feature 100% polarization and Costa’s 580 technology. These sunglasses are also made with a wide range of tints to match your preferences.

Costa Blackfin PRO polarized sunglasses for fishing have been a tried and tested tool for true anglers. They feature a mirror coating and 580G LightWAVE(r) glass lens that is thinner than typical polarized glass. Their frames are made with durable co-injected nylon and use an eco-resin process that uses castor oil instead of petroleum.

If you’re going fishing at night or in low-light conditions, you should invest in a pair of yellow-tinted sunglasses.

The right polarized sunglasses can also help you protect your eyes from harmful UV rays. For offshore fishing, a blue-mirror and gray-base lens is recommended, while copper or amber-base lenses with a gold mirror are great for inshore waters. The lens density and shape are crucial factors in choosing the right pair of sunglasses. However, the price of these glasses can be quite high.
